Two adjoining bars slide down an inclined plane. The mass of the first bar is 2 kg, the second is 3 kg. The coefficients of friction between the bars and the surface of the plane are 0.1 and 0.3. The angle of inclination of the plane to the horizon line is 45°. Determine the force with which the bars press against each other.
